The SCT is FAR safer than just the bullydog. The generic tuners (bullydog, banks, and so on) actually have terrible effects because of timing. If you've ever seen the spray patterns on the pistons from generic tuners you'd know that the timing is terrible and causes cylinder pressures to sky rocket. Custom tuned SCT's will have a nice pattern sprayed right into the pistons bowl, where it should be. The SCT is the best and the safest. Not to mention the detrimental effects the generic tuners have on the transmisson's. For tranny tuning alone, it's worth it to get the SCT.
